Unmarried Partner Visa If you are in a durable relationship with a British Citizen or a UK Permanent Resident (PR) holder, have co-habited for a minimum of two consecutive years and have amalgamated your finances to a significant degree, you will be eligible to apply for a Unmarried partner visa entitling you and your family to move to the UK. For a UK unmarried partner visa, the couple has to show evidence and proof to prove that their relationship has been ongoing for 2 years or more now. The Unmarried Partner visa is for those that, under Appendix FM of the UK Immigration Rules, is a person who has been living with the applicant in a relationship similar to a marriage or civil partnership for a minimum of two years prior to the date of application; and intend to continue living together. On arrival in France, you have three months to contact the OFII, who will carry out a medical examination, issue you with a residence permit and may ask you to sign the Contrat d’Accueil et d’Intégration (CAI). You must enter France within 3 months of receiving the visa, and you have to register with the local branch of the OFII (Office Français de l’Immigration et de l’Intégration) within two months of arriving in France. After intense pressure from unmarried couples who had been separated due to travel bans put in place, France has joined the list of 7 other European countries who will now allow partners and families to reunite. On August 3, Switzerland joined Denmark, Norway, Netherlands, Iceland, Austria, and the Czech Republic in allowing someone from a third national country to join their partner in one of these countries, if they could provide proof of the relationship.
